Knowles C06CF4R7C-9UN-X1T is a C06CF4R7C-9UN-X1T from Knowles, part of the Multilayer Ceramic Capacitors MLCC - SMD/SMT. It is designed for 250V 4.7pF NP0 0603 Multilayer Ceramic Capacitors MLCC - SMD/SMT ROHS. This product comes in a 0603 package and is sold as Tape & Reel (TR). Key features include:
- Voltage Rated: 250V
- Capacitance: 4.7pF
- Temperature Coefficient: NP0
Additional details: This product is environmentally friendly, does not contain a battery, and weighs approximately 0.001 grams.
